Graduate Technical Engineer                                       Tyrone                                                £24-26K      

A leading Manufacturing Company are currently looking for a Graduate Technical Engineer to join their ever-expanding business. They require a Technical Engineer to come on board and ensure all technical aspects of the business are up to standards for operating procedures.

The role offers the chance to join a great team with high ambitions. The successful candidate will be presented with the opportunity to work on new and innovative projects and grow with the company as it continually progresses through the industry.

Responsibilities of the Role:

  • Support the engineering team during planning, design, development, installation, maintenance and troubleshooting process of all manufacturing equipment and projects.
  • Carry out scheduled technical maintenance tasks in maintaining site assets and ensuring equipment availability.
  • Inspection of all manufacturing and technical equipment in order help with production efficiency.
  • Develop preventative technical maintenance strategies through analysing existing systems and operations.
  • Ensure projects are completed on schedule through communicating with other engineers and team members.
  • Provide technical expertise to multiple projects and budgets.
  • Suggest ideas for continuous improvement within manufacturing and operations, and assist in the implementation of ideas put forward.
  • Work with the operations department to ensure optimal flow and working of technical equipment.
  • Preform any relevant site visits if requested.

Experience and Knowledge:

The candidate should have one year’s relevant experience in a similar role with comparable responsibilities. They should also hold a degree in Chemical Engineering or similar and have a keen interest in the Manufacturing industry.
